This course offers an introduction to the history and culture of Western art music, commonly known as classical music. While sketching an overview of important works, events, places, figures, and movements from the medieval period up to the present day, the course will focus on providing students with the knowledge, vocabulary, and listening skills required to locate themselves in relation to this vast and diverse body of music. No previous musical experience is required.


Enrollment Information REF-F25 Students who have previously taken MUSIC 1201(European Music from the Middle Ages, Renaissance, and Baroque) and/or MUSIC 1202 (Classical Music from 1750 to the Present) should be aware that MUSIC 1205 incorporates content from both courses and might consider taking MUSIC 2207 or MUSIC 2208.
